8541ed3dfd98021cb7759ff3139d11329608588c125a1415f2023f099837f5ba

713949 (222969 blocks ago)

123102837

⏴ Block 713948 (b31297d7...2a7) | Block 713950 ⏵ | Latest block ⏭

Metadata

12/2/25, 4:10 am UTC (309d 16:18:43 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.6598 SENT

Transactions (0)

Show raw details